Paracetamol, or acetaminophen, is a ubiquitous analgesic and antipyretic that has been a mainstay in pain and fever management for decades. Its widespread use stems from a combination of effective pain relief and a relatively favorable safety profile when compared to other pain medications. Understanding the underlying science, including the paracetamol mechanism of action, can enhance its appropriate use and patient outcomes.
The precise mechanisms by which paracetamol exerts its analgesic and antipyretic effects are still areas of active research. However, current understanding points to a dual action. Firstly, it is believed to inhibit cyclooxygenase (COX) enzymes, particularly COX-2, in the central nervous system. This inhibition reduces the production of prostaglandins, which are key mediators of pain and fever. This central action explains why paracetamol has limited anti-inflammatory effects in the periphery, differentiating it from NSAIDs. Secondly, paracetamol is metabolized to a compound called AM404 in the brain, which has been shown to activate cannabinoid receptors and TRPV1 receptors, both of which are involved in pain modulation.
The historical trajectory of paracetamol is equally fascinating. From its initial synthesis in the late 19th century to its widespread global adoption, paracetamol has undergone significant scientific scrutiny. Early concerns about its safety were eventually allayed, leading to its status as a preferred analgesic. The evolution of its use also highlights the importance of rigorous research in understanding drug interactions and optimizing therapeutic efficacy. For instance, understanding how paracetamol interacts with other medications is crucial for preventing adverse events and ensuring patient safety.
Furthermore, discussions around acetaminophen pregnancy safety emphasize the need for cautious use and consultation with healthcare providers. While generally considered safe for short-term use during pregnancy, the latest research continues to refine our understanding of its long-term effects. Similarly, the exploration of paracetamol veterinary use showcases its applicability beyond human medicine, albeit with specific dosage considerations for different species.
